Real Monarchs Split 2-2 Draw with Austin Bold FC

HERRIMAN, Utah 
(Wednesday, October 16, 2019) – 
Real Monarchs SLC 
(15-10-8, 53 points) split the points with Austin Bold FC after a 2-2 draw at Zions Bank Stadium in front of 1,503 fans on Wednesday night.




FW
Julian Vazquez
tallied his first professional goal in the 5
th
minute while FW
Kyle Coffee
scored his second goal in as many games.

The Monarchs got a dream start to the match as DF
Kalen Ryden
sent a long ball upfield where Vazquez picked up the ball. With time and space, Vazquez beat Bold FC goalkeeper Diego Restrepo at the far post in the 5
th
minute. While the Monarchs kept pressure through the first half, Austin Bold FC found an equalizer quickly in the 18
th
minute as Ema Twumasi slipped in a shot at the near the post. While the Monarchs had a penalty kick opportunity to take regain the lead, Restrepo was able to make the save and at the teams entered the locker room with a goal apiece.




Coffee put the Monarchs in the lead again at the 55
th
minute when he dribbled around a crowded penalty area to open space and take a shot that Restrepo got a touch to but ultimately wasn’t able to keep out.  The lead was short lived and just two minutes later, André Lima flicked in a header within six-yards of goal. Both sides fought for the game-winner as the match turned heated, as Bold FC’s Kléber earned a red card in the 86
th
minute, leaving the Monarchs with a man-advantage. Real Monarchs pressed in the dying moments but couldn’t find the back of the net and split the points at Zions Bank Stadium.

GOAL SCORING RUNDOWN


SLC: Julian Vazquez, 5th minute:
Kalen Ryden started off the attack from the back with a long ball over the top where a Bold FC defender got a touch with his head, but Vazquez was quick to recover. With the ball at his feet and space ahead of him, Vazquez went one-on-one with the goalkeeper and slotted a shot into the far post for a dream start.




AUS: Ema Twumasi (André Lima), 18th minute:
In a similar fashion to the first goal, a play that came from the backline fell near the middle of the pitch where Lima took one touch to keep the ball in the air and get over the Monarchs defense. Twumasi slid into the gaps and with time and space ran the ball to cooly convert for the equalizer.




SLC: Kyle Coffee (Steve Jasso), 55th minute:
Picking up the pass from Steve Jasso, Coffee dribbled through traffic at the top of the box before he was able to create an opening to take a chance towards goal. Coffee found the shot which Restrepo got a touch to, but it wasn’t enough as the ball found the back of the net.




AUS: André Lima (Sean McFarlane), 57th minute:
Under pressure, McFalane ran the ball along the end line before quickly sending the ball just in front of the net. Lima was the first to get to the ball, and flicked the header in towards goal to once again level out the scoring.




KEY SAVES AND DEFENSIVE STOPS


AUS: Diego Restrepo, 24
th
minute: After being taken down in the penalty area, Jack Blake stepped up to the penalty spot that he blasted down the middle. Initially, Restrepo began to dive to the left and fell low for Blake’s high shot, but he reached out a hand and protected the net with a huge deflection.




NOTES:


- Midfielder Ricardo Avila (ankle) and Defender James Moberg (hamstring) out of action due to injury. Defender Konrad Plewa also missed tonight’s action due to a red card suspension.




- FW Julian Vazquez’s goal marked his first professional, becoming the 21
st
player to score for the Monarchs in 2019.




- With the draw, Real Monarchs remain in a tight race for 4
th
in the West. A win or a draw on Saturday against Sacramento will clinch at least one home match for the club in the Championship Playoffs, while a loss and results elsewhere could still secure the 4
th
spot. The match will be broadcast live nationally on ESPN3.
